Money in any such reserve fund shall be drawn therefrom only upon demands authenticated by the signature of the accountant of the district; provided, however, that the board may, in its discretion, direct and authorize the payment from such reserve fund, by the treasurer, without such authenticated demand, (i) of bonds of the issue in connection with which such reserve fund is so established when due upon maturity or call, or of coupons pertaining to bonds of such issue when due, but only upon presentation and surrender of such bonds or coupons, (ii) of interest upon registered bonds of such issue when due, or (iii) of premiums, if any, due upon the redemption of any such bonds.
